Output 317384f6d4dcb27d5531bfb620d36efe9c7002d24c05add7a70de72510b3122e:0

value
5641110
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 478afee95cda0a1731395274650a4edcef6df059 OP_EQUALVERIFY OP_CHECKSIG
address
17XHVDQSDoERo4UNVr3nU84jH46PxU9L23
transaction
317384f6d4dcb27d5531bfb620d36efe9c7002d24c05add7a70de72510b3122e
spent
true